Mandelson: Don't panic over trade talks offer

The EU’s top trade negotiator today told EU governments not to panic over world trade talks, saying they would make a “terrible mistake” if they softened Europe’s stance on farm and other subsidies now.

“Surely it would be the wrong reaction, and a terrible mistake for the EU, at the first sign of serious movement in the talks – movement that we have been calling for – to lose confidence and pull in our horns,” EU Trade Commissioner Peter Mandelson told a special meeting of EU foreign ministers.
